1. Rank Math SEO

Ratings: 4.9 out of 5 stars (Source: https://wordpress.org/plugins/seo-by-rank-math/)

The powerful WordPress SEO plugin is adored by all SEO professionals. This user-friendly plugin optimizes your website both for search engines and social media. You can use it for meta titles, descriptions, and Open Graph metadata. This all-in-one plugin is designed for both beginners and advanced users.

Its dashboard includes 21 different modules for you to toggle on or off depending on your needs.

Features:

  • Advanced on-page SEO analysis alongside multiple keyword optimization
  • Built-in schema markup generator.
  • Analytics and Google Search Console integration
  • AI-powered content suggestions 
  • Modular framework for better performance

Pricing:

The free version offers features like XML sitemap and Google Search Console features. The Pro plan starts at around $6.99–$7.99 per month (billed annually), which is roughly $59–$95 per year

2. Yoast SEO

Ratings: 4.8 out of 5 stars (source: https://wordpress.org/plugins/wordpress-seo/)

When you are talking about the WordPress SEO Plugin, you can’t miss this tool. For many years, it has been offering go-to solutions to SEO professionals.

With this tool, you can optimize your website content and technical SEO. It’s designed to make SEO straightforward. This plugin’s famous traffic light system (red, orange, green) gives users quick, easy-to-understand feedback right where they write their posts.

The tool makes the entire SEO process easier. Moreover, you can integrate Yoast SEO with popular tools like SEMRush, Seriously Simple Podcasting, WP Recipe Maker, and Jetpack.

Features:

  • Real-time content and readability analysis.
  • Focus keyword optimization.
  • XML sitemap generation.
  • Basic schema implementation.
  • Internal linking suggestions (included in premium plan)
  • Social media preview (for Facebook & Twitter)

Pricing:

The free version is available, but the premium plan starts around $99/year per site

3. All-In-One SEO

Ratings: 4.7 out of 5 stars (Source: https://wordpress.org/plugins/all-in-one-seo-pack/)

AIOSEO is one of the original WordPress SEO Plugins. It simplifies the entire process of optimizing your WordPress website.

From bloggers to business owners to beginner SEO specialists, everyone can see this versatile tool. Its interface is beginner-friendly but also offers advanced features for experienced professionals.

AIOSEO provides go-to tools for on-page optimization in the WordPress editor. The plugin features an SEO setup wizard to configure the basics of your site’s SEO.

Features:

  • Easy setup for quick configuration.
  • Smart tag generation for meta titles and meta descriptions.
  • Top-notch local SEO support.
  • Redirection manager and SEO audit checklist
  • Integration with Google tools
  • Advanced Schema Markup

Pricing:

It offers a free version with tools including basic SEO features and XML sitemaps. The Basic version starts at $49.60/year for one website and includes advanced features like WooCommerce SEO and social media integrations.

4. The SEO Framework

Ratings: 4.9 out of 5 stars (Source: https://wordpress.org/plugins/autodescription/)

The SEO Framework is a fast WordPress plugin known to analyze your website and produce critical meta tags. Known for its performance, it ensures fast loading times to avoid database bloat and slow queries. Additionally, it helps search engines index the best versions with its SEO attack protection.

Features:

  • Automatic generation of engaging meta titles and descriptions.
  • Built-in XML sitemap and structured data.
  • Beginner-friendly settings for quick setup. 
  • Lightweight and fast for performance.
  • A complete white-label interface.
  • Advanced canonical URL to prevent duplicate content issues.
  • Social media metadata support.
  • Strong focus on security and privacy.

Pricing:

Its free version is available to get all features. $7–$10/month paid extension is also available for use.

5. SEOPress

Rating: 4.8 out of 5 stars (Source: https://wordpress.org/plugins/wp-seopress/)

SEOPress is more than just another best SEO plugin for WordPress. The tool offers a complete optimization suite to balance power with simplicity. It has excellent ability to deliver advanced SEO capabilities without overwhelming the user interface. Unlike many plugins that rely heavily on cluttered dashboards, it keeps things clean and fast while offering enterprise-level features.

SEOPress focuses on three key areas: performance, flexibility, and control. It is lightweight and doesn’t add unnecessary load to your website. At the same time, it provides deep customization options to end-users.

Features:

  • Complete on-page SEO optimization.
  • Advanced schema markup.
  • XML, HTML, image, video, and Google News sitemaps.
  • Built-in Google Analytics and Search Console integration.
  • AI-powered metadata generation (supports multiple AI tools).
  • Redirection manager with 404 error tracking.
  • WooCommerce and Local SEO support.
  • White-label functionality (great for agencies).

Pricing:

Its free version is available with multiple SEO features. The SEOPress Pro plan starts at approximately $49 per year for a single site. There are also multi-site options available, such as around $59 per year for up to five sites and about $149 per year for unlimited sites

6. WP Meta SEO

Ratings: 4.3 out of 5 stars (Source: https://wordpress.org/support/plugin/wp-meta-seo/reviews/)

WP Meta SEO is a powerful WordPress SEO plugin centred around bulk optimization and time-saving workflows. Unlike many other SEO plugins that require editing each page individually, this plugin allows you to manage an entire website’s SEO from a centralized dashboard. Thus, making it useful for large websites with hundreds of pages.

Key Features:

  • Bulk edit meta titles, descriptions, and SEO link titles from a single interface.
  • Advanced image SEO optimization.
  • XML and HTML sitemap generation for better indexing.
  • 404 error detection with one-click redirection management.
  • Live on-page SEO analysis with content scoring.
  • Google Analytics and Search Console integration for data-driven insights.
  • Social media metadata (Facebook, Twitter Open Graph support).
  • Canonical URL management to prevent duplicate content issues.
  • Built-in broken link checker and redirect manager.

Pricing:

WP Meta SEO’s free version has been merged into the premium offering. The Pro version is available at a one-time cost of around $49.

8. Slim SEO

Rating: 4.7 out of 5 stars (Source: https://wordpress.org/plugins/slim-seo/)

Slim SEO is a lightweight WordPress SEO plugin that automates essential SEO tasks with minimal setup. It automatically manages meta tags, XML sitemaps, schema markup, redirects, and social media metadata, allowing users to optimize their websites without extensive configuration. Designed for speed and simplicity, it is an excellent choice for users who want reliable SEO performance without a feature-heavy interface.

Key Features

  • Automatic Meta Tags: Generates SEO titles and meta descriptions automatically.
  • XML Sitemaps: Creates and updates XML sitemaps for better search engine indexing.
  • Schema Markup: Adds structured data for posts, pages, organizations, and more.
  • Open Graph & Twitter Cards: Optimizes content previews for social media sharing.
  • Automatic Redirects: Helps preserve SEO value when URLs change.
  • Image SEO: Automatically fills missing image alt text using image titles.
  • Robots Meta Management: Handles indexing settings without manual configuration.
  • Lightweight Performance: Built for speed with minimal impact on website performance.
  • WooCommerce SEO Support: Provides basic SEO optimization for WooCommerce stores.

Pricing

Slim SEO offers a free version with essential SEO features for most WordPress websites. For users who need advanced functionality, Slim SEO Pro starts at $59/year for a single website and includes additional tools such as a schema builder, advanced redirects, link management, and more. Higher-tier plans are available for multiple websites and agencies.

9. SmartCrawl

Rating: 4.8 out of 5 stars (Source: https://wordpress.org/plugins/smartcrawl-seo/)

SmartCrawl is a user-friendly WordPress SEO plugin developed by WPMU DEV that helps improve your website’s search engine visibility through automated SEO optimization. It offers essential features such as meta tag management, XML sitemaps, schema markup, keyword analysis, and content optimization within an intuitive interface. SmartCrawl strikes a balance between ease of use and advanced functionality, making it suitable for users who want comprehensive SEO tools without a steep learning curve.

Best For: Small to medium-sized businesses, bloggers, agencies, and WordPress users looking for an easy-to-use SEO plugin with advanced optimization features.

Key Features

  • Automated SEO recommendations and optimization.
  • Custom SEO titles and meta descriptions.
  • XML sitemap generation.
  • Schema markup support.
  • Open Graph and Twitter Card integration.
  • Keyword analysis and content optimization.
  • Automatic URL redirects.
  • Broken link monitoring.
  • Robots.txt and .htaccess management.
  • Google Search Console integration.

Pricing

SmartCrawl offers a free version with core SEO features. SmartCrawl Pro is available through a WPMU DEV membership, which starts at $3/month (billed annually) and includes SmartCrawl Pro along with other premium WordPress plugins, website management tools, hosting options, and dedicated support. Higher-tier plans are available for agencies and users managing multiple websites.

10. Squirrly SEO

Rating: 4.6 out of 5 stars (Source: https://wordpress.org/plugins/squirrly-seo/)

Squirrly SEO is an AI-powered WordPress SEO plugin designed to help users optimize their websites for both search engines and readers. It combines keyword research, real-time content optimization, technical SEO, site audits, rank tracking, and AI-driven recommendations in a single platform. With guided workflows and actionable suggestions, Squirrly SEO is suitable for users who want a comprehensive, data-driven approach to SEO.

Best For: Bloggers, content creators, small businesses, marketers, and agencies looking for AI-assisted SEO optimization and advanced SEO management.

Key Features

  • AI-powered SEO assistant with real-time optimization.
  • Keyword research and content optimization.
  • SEO audits with actionable recommendations.
  • Rank tracking for target keywords.
  • XML sitemap generation.
  • Schema markup support.
  • Focus Pages for tracking SEO performance.
  • Open Graph and Twitter Card integration.
  • Google Search Console and Google Analytics integration.
  • WooCommerce SEO support.

Pricing

Squirrly SEO offers a free version with access to essential SEO tools and limited monthly usage. Paid plans start at $29.99/month, adding more AI credits, advanced SEO features, rank tracking, audits, and higher usage limits. Higher-tier plans are available for businesses and agencies managing multiple websites.

What Factors Should Be Considered Before Choosing SEO Plugins for WordPress?

Choosing the right plugins for your WordPress website is vital to building a strong SEO foundation. Plugins simplify optimization; selecting the wrong ones may slow down your overall website. Before installing SEO plugins, it’s vital to evaluate certain factors to ensure long-term performance and scalability. This becomes even more important as AI-driven SEO tools continue to shape modern SEO strategies 

Compatibility with Your Website Setup

Not all SEO plugins work seamlessly with every website theme. Before choosing an SEO plugin, ensure that the plugin is compatible with the current WordPress version. Poor compatibility may cause broken layouts or technical errors that impact SEO performance.

Features and Functionality

Different SEO plugins have different capabilities. Some plugins focus on on-page optimization, while others focus on technical SEO, XML sitemaps, schema markup, and keyword analysis. Choose a plugin that aligns with your SEO goals.

Ease of Use

A complicated interface can automatically slow down your workflow. Choose a plugin with a clean dashboard, clear recommendations, and guided setup. 

Impact on Website Speed

Heavy plugins enhance your loading time and directly affect rankings and user experience. Always check how lightweight and optimized the plugin is.

Regular Updates and Support

SEO evolves constantly, and your plugin should keep up. Choose plugins that are frequently updated and backed by active support teams. 

Integration with Other Tools

An effective SEO strategy makes use of tools like Google Analytics, Search Console, and social media platforms. Make sure your plugin integrates smoothly with these tools to provide better insights and tracking capabilities.

Reviews, Ratings, and Reputation

Before installing these plugins, check user reviews and ratings. Plugins with a strong reputation are generally more reliable and well-maintained.
